redis分片扩容 redis自定义分片

导读:Redis是一款高性能的NoSQL数据库,支持自定义分片功能 。本文将介绍如何使用Redis进行自定义分片,并探讨其优势和适用场景 。
1. 什么是Redis自定义分片?
Redis自定义分片是指在Redis集群中,将数据按照一定规则分散到多个节点上存储 , 以达到提高系统性能和可扩展性的目的 。用户可以根据自己的需求,制定不同的分片策略 。
2. Redis自定义分片的优势
a. 提高系统性能:将数据分散到多个节点上存储,可以减轻单节点负担 , 提高系统的并发处理能力和吞吐量 。
b. 增强系统可扩展性:随着业务的增长,可以通过添加新的节点来扩展系统容量,而无需对整个系统进行重构 。
c. 提升数据安全性:在分布式环境下,即使某个节点出现故障 , 也不会影响整个系统的正常运行,从而保障数据的安全性 。
3. Redis自定义分片的适用场景
【redis分片扩容 redis自定义分片】a. 数据量大、访问频繁的应用场景,如电商网站、社交网络等 。
b. 对数据安全性要求较高的应用场景,如金融、医疗等 。
c. 需要动态扩展系统容量的应用场景,如在线游戏、云计算等 。
总结:Redis自定义分片是提高系统性能和可扩展性的重要手段,可以根据不同的应用场景进行灵活配置 。在实际应用中,需要综合考虑数据安全性、性能、可扩展性等因素,选择合适的分片策略 。

    推荐阅读